What is the difference between a hostel and a hotel?

It’s not just about saving money at this budget-friendly, backpacker style accommodation. Our local experts have looked into all the advantages of staying in a hostel over a hotel. Unlike your standard accommodation where you have your own room, you’ll be sharing digs — and that means making loads of new mates. Book a bed in a dormitory and share facilities like bathrooms, kitchens and common rooms. (Although, some hostels have private rooms too.) Hostels offer the basics, so you can forget about luxuries like coffee makers or TVs in your room. It’s all part of keeping costs low. How do I choose a good hostel? 

We know you’re keen to save a few bucks, but price isn’t the only thing to consider. Location is a big one. Make sure your hostel is in a safe area and close to the action — you don’t want to be wasting money on ride shares or public transport. Then, research your room. How many people are in a dormitory? If a 20-bed dorm sounds like a recipe for no sleep, go for a hostel that has smaller rooms. Check out the bathroom situation. Does your room include a bathroom or is there only one per floor? Also, is there a curfew? You don’t want to be locked out after a big night! Finally, read a few of our millions of trusted reviews for some insight.

What amenities should I look for in a hostel? 

It’s the little things that set an awesome hostel apart from a so-so one. Wanna save money on food? Go for a hostel with a kitchen and whip up your famous spag bol. Looking for a good time? Choose one that comes with a bar (or even a pool!). Also make sure it has plenty of room choice, whether you’re looking for a four-bed dorm, one with 20 beds, a private room or rooms with or without a bathroom. Then there are things like making sure your hostel has a 24/7 front desk, good security, lockers, comfortable common areas, complimentary breakfasts and of course, reliable WiFi
